O R D E R
Heard Mr. E.Manoharan, Learned Counsel for the Petitioner, Mr. A.Kumaraguru, Learned Senior Panel Counsel appearing for the First to Third Respondents and Mr. N.G.R.Prasad, Learned Counsel for the Fourth and Fifth Respondents and perused the materials placed on record, apart from the pleadings of the parties.
2.
The Writ Petition has been filed for directing the First and Third Respondents to direct the Fourth Respondent to deduct the loan dues owed by the employees of the Fourth Respondent to the Society of the Petitioner from their salary and transfer them to the Society of the Petitioner as per Section 60 of the Multi-State Co-operative Societies Act, 2002, and as per the authorization granted by the employees of the Fourth Respondent for such deduction and transfer to the Society of the Petitioner. 3.
Learned Counsel for the Petitioner submits that the relief sought by the Petitioner in the Writ Petition has been granted by the Respondents and he has made an endorsement to that effect in the court record. In view of the same, nothing remains for further consideration in the Writ Petition. 3/5
In the result, the Writ Petition is disposed. No costs. 29.11.2023 Index: Yes/No NCC: Yes/No Note: Issue order copy by 26.03.2024.
